RC3225F2940CS Equivalent & Substitute Parts Reference
Part Overview
The RC3225F2940CS is a 294 Ohm ±1% thick film chip resistor manufactured by Samsung Electro-Mechanics, rated at 0.333W (1/3W) power dissipation in a 1210 (3225 Metric) surface mount package. This component is classified as Active product status with full RoHS3 compliance and unlimited moisture sensitivity rating (MSL 1).
Substitute parts are identified when equivalent electrical specifications and mechanical compatibility are maintained across the same package footprint and performance envelope. The primary substitute listed is the ERJ-14NF2940U from Panasonic Electronic Components, which shares identical resistance, tolerance, and package dimensions while offering higher power rating and automotive qualification.

Substitute Part Grouping Explanation
Substitution eligibility for the RC3225F2940CS is determined by strict adherence to the following parameters:
Critical Electrical Parameters (Must Match):
- Resistance value: 294 Ohms
- Tolerance: ±1%
- Temperature coefficient: ±100ppm/°C
- Operating temperature range: -55°C ~ 155°C
Critical Mechanical Parameters (Must Match):
- Package / Case: 1210 (3225 Metric)
- Number of terminations: 2
- Composition: Thick Film
Allowable Variation Parameters:
- Power rating may be equal to or greater than 0.333W (1/3W)
- Physical dimensions may vary within standard 1210 package tolerances
- Product status may differ (Active or Not For New Designs)
- Certifications and features may exceed base requirements (e.g., AEC-Q200 automotive qualification)
The ERJ-14NF2940U qualifies as a direct substitute because it maintains all critical electrical and mechanical parameters while offering enhanced power rating (0.5W vs. 0.333W) and automotive-grade qualification.

Frequently Asked Questions (FAQ)
Q: Can ERJ-14NF2940U be used as a direct replacement for RC3225F2940CS on existing PCBs?
A: Yes. Both parts share identical 1210 (3225 Metric) package dimensions, resistance value (294 Ohms ±1%), tolerance (±1%), and operating temperature range (-55°C ~ 155°C). Physical dimensions are within standard package tolerances (length 3.20mm identical, width 2.55mm vs. 2.50mm, height 0.66mm vs. 0.70mm). No PCB redesign is required.
Q: What is the significance of the higher power rating on the ERJ-14NF2940U?
A: The ERJ-14NF2940U is rated at 0.5W (1/2W) compared to the RC3225F2940CS at 0.333W (1/3W). A higher power rating indicates greater thermal dissipation capability. In applications where the resistor dissipates power near or at the 0.333W limit, the substitute provides additional thermal margin and improved reliability. However, if the application requires only 0.333W or less, both parts perform identically.
Q: Why is ERJ-14NF2940U marked "Not For New Designs"?
A: This designation indicates that Panasonic has classified this part as mature or legacy. While the part remains available and fully functional, Panasonic recommends using alternative current-generation parts for new product development. Use ERJ-14NF2940U only when supply of the primary part (RC3225F2940CS) is unavailable or when automotive qualification is specifically required.
Q: Are there compliance or certification differences between these parts?
A: Both parts are RoHS3 compliant, REACH unaffected, and carry MSL 1 (unlimited moisture sensitivity). The key difference is that ERJ-14NF2940U includes AEC-Q200 automotive qualification, which certifies the part for automotive applications. RC3225F2940CS does not list automotive qualification. If automotive compliance is required, ERJ-14NF2940U is the appropriate choice.
Q: Can these parts be used interchangeably in high-temperature applications?
A: Yes. Both parts share identical operating temperature range (-55°C ~ 155°C) and temperature coefficient (±100ppm/°C). They perform identically across the full temperature range. Selection between them should be based on power dissipation requirements and product status considerations, not temperature performance.
Q: What is the impact of the slight dimensional variation between these parts?
A: The dimensional differences (width 2.55mm vs. 2.50mm, height 0.66mm vs. 0.70mm) fall within standard 1210 package tolerances and do not affect PCB compatibility, soldering, or electrical performance. Both parts will fit standard 1210 footprints without modification.
